Custom-Voiced Pickups Provide a Balanced Tone With slightly hotter output than typical vintage pickups and a powerful combination of alnico magnets, these custom-voiced pickups produce a perfect balance of clean, dirty rhythm and singing lead tones. The neck pickup based on a '54 Strat pickup uses oversized Alnico 3 magnets for a warm, round tone. The reverse-wound middle pickup with specially treated alnico magnets cancels hum when used with the neck or bridge pickup. The alnico five bridge pickup is voiced to be hotter without losing sparkly treble. Dynamic and Responsive Playing With Alnico Magnets The powerful alnico magnets in the custom pickups make them dynamically responsive to your picking technique and volume knob adjustments. From delicate cleans to raunchy overdrive, you'll feel more connected to your guitar. The pickups also retain clarity during complex chords and fast leads. Their high sensitivity lets your playing shine. Reverse-Wound Middle Pickup Cancels Hum The reverse-wound middle pickup is a smart way to eliminate hum in the two and four switch positions. By reversing the coil windings, it cancels out electromagnetic interference when combined with the neck or bridge pickup.
